Working as part of a team in the dedicated Style Studio as a Personal Stylist, you will play an active role in achieving our brand ambition. You will conduct exciting and inspirational styling consultations for our customers, host style talks, share fashion trends and offer instant style advice to our 'walk-in' customers. Your love of fashion will help our customers find pieces they will fall in love with, delivering a unique and memorable experience that is personalised and sees customers returning time and time again.

Key Responsibilities

  • Navigate the wide range of brands we offer to find pieces that our customers will love.
  • Use your knowledge of colour analysis, body shape profiling and consultative selling to generate sales across the fashion floor.
  • Support your department when required with general shop-keeping tasks and excellent customer service.
  • Engage new customers through social media channels and use your creative skills to create 'fashion theatre' on the shop floor to help drive and maximise sales and profit.
  • Be an ambassador for the John Lewis brand.

Essential skills/experience you'll need

  • A passion for everything fashion and styling.
  • Excellent customer service skills that allow you to build a rapport with customers.
  • Great organisation skills to organise your own diary of scheduled appointments.

Desirable skills/experience you may have

  • Experience in using social media platforms to create content and engage audiences.

We want all of our Partners to have a good work-life balance and we support flexible working. This might mean flexible or compressed hours, job sharing or shorter hour contracts, where possible. Please discuss this further with the hiring manager during your interview.
